31-year-old man pleads not guilty in child rape case

A 31-year-old Lawrence man charged with two counts of aggravated indecent liberties with a child under the age of 14 and one count of rape of a child under 14 pleaded not guilty to the charges Friday.

The defendant is alleged to have made two girls watch pornography, exposed himself and touched them sexually between December 2013 and May 2014, according to the affidavit in support of his arrest.

The man was arrested on suspicion of the charges Oct. 3. He was released two weeks later after posting a $60,000 bond. The man used a bond company for his bail, meaning he only paid 10 percent, or $6,000, for his release.

He will next appear in court for a hearing April 17, and a jury trial is scheduled for May 29. If convicted, he could spend the rest of his life in prison.
